General Psychology is one of the most popular subjects to study in Iowa. With 1,272 degrees and certificates handed out in 2020-2021, it ranked 6th out of all the majors we track in the state.

Our 2023 rankings named Iowa State University the best school in Iowa for general psychology students working on their master’s degree. Located in the small city of Ames, Iowa State is a public college with a very large student population.
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around you if you attend Loras College. The school came in at #2 on this year’s Best General Psychology Master’s Degree Schools in Iowa list. Loras is a small private not-for-profit school located in the small city of Dubuque.
The excellent master’s degree programs at University of Northern Iowa helped the school earn the #3 place on this year’s ranking of the best general psychology schools in Iowa. UNI is a medium-sized public school located in the city of Cedar Falls.
